> Add dedicated hypervisor hooks for getting known TSC/CPU frequencies
> instead of overriding seemingly generic platform hooks, and explicitly
> priotize hypervisor-provided frequencies over native methods, but do NOT

s/priotize/prioritize/

> clobber the frequency obtained from trusted firmware.  While shuffling the
> hooks around is arguably "six of one, half dozen of the other", scoping
> them to x86_hyper_init makes their purpose more obvious, and allows for
> explicitly defining the priority of sources (as is done here).
> 
> As is already done when trusted firmware provides the TSC frequency, ignore

Word "ignore" is duplicated.

> ignore tsc_early_khz if the exact TSC frequency was obtained from the
> hypervisor, as attempting to refine the TSC frequency when running in a VM
> is all but guaranteed to cause problems sooner or later due to the
> calibration sources being emulated devices in the vast majority of setups.
